Pacers 1/0 AWG Marine Battery Cable is designed to exceed stringent specifications. This UL-approved cable is manufactured in-house in Sarasota, FL, USA, which ensures high quality. Marine installations can occur in tight, enclosed spaces that have sharp turns where the installation process can quickly become difficult. Pacer makes the installation process easier. This is achieved by creating a flexible yet tough marine cable.
This 1/0 AWG marine battery cable can handle the toughest environments. This marine battery cable is made from Type III Class K tinned copper. The copper resists corrosion and helps to extend the life of the marine cable. Then, the cable is insulated with a durable and flexible proprietary PVC jacket. These things all come together to make the highest quality marine cable available.

Characteristics:
- Conductor: Annealed stranded tinned copper ASTM B172 Class K
- Insulation: -20 C to 105 C Flexible, Color-Coded PVC
- Temperature Rating: 105 C Dry, 75 C Wet, 60 C Oil
- Voltage Rating: 600-V
- Resistant to: Acid, Alkali, Abrasion, Flame, Gasoline, Oil and Moisture
Specifications:
- AWG: 1/0
- Color: Red
- Length: 50 ft.
- Conductor Stranding: 19x 56/0.0100
- Nom. Ins. Thickness: 0.080
- Nom. O.D.: 0.600
- Nom. Circular Mils: 106400
- Nom. MM2: 53.9
- Approximate Weight: 450 lb/m
Compliances:
- UL Standard 1426 BC-5W2
- AWM 1232/1284
- MTW
- CSA: TEW
- ABYC: E-11.15
- Coast Guard: 33 CFR part 183 Subpart 1
